Director – Product Diligence M&A

Crosslake Technologies
Summary
Join Crosslake, a firm supporting changemakers in buying, building, and running better technology, as a Director in their product and technology buy-side and sell-side diligence practice. Reporting to the Managing Director, you will manage teams to deliver successful client engagements, evolve product diligence practice materials, support business development, and innovate new service offerings. This role requires strong analytical and communication skills, experience in market and customer needs analysis, and managing software/SaaS offerings and product P&Ls. You will manage teams, develop team members, and handle consulting engagements with executive-level clients. The ideal candidate is a team player, coachable, and driven to achieve results.
